    Before doing anything official assess it yourself. Using Google Earth measure distances to the nearest dwellings 30 degrees either side of the range centre line. Look at the backstop and see what topography may assist ie a hill or in a gully. Consider 35 degrees elevation as the max muzzle elevation and can anything get away and what's to stop it down range.
    With reactive targets are they mounted so as to deflect bullet fragments down.
    Common sense says you've done this already and if you decide to or are compelled to register then having data in hand must surely be a plus.
